Does a building permit expire?

Any building permit issued shall be deemed abandoned and invalid unless the work authorized by it shall be commenced within six (6) months of the date of issuance.  The building official, upon written request, may issue extensions.  Work under such a permit, in the opinion of the building official,  must proceed in good faith continuously to completion so far as reasonably practicable under the circumstances.  For more information see 780 CMR Section 111.8 Expiration of Permit.
